AI Contract Overview
The contract involves providing scheduled maintenance, troubleshooting, and repair services for oxygen concentrators and ventilators, ensuring all work adheres to manufacturer standards. It is designated as a subcontract specifically set aside for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Businesses (SDVOSBC), reflecting a commitment to supporting this particular business community. The contract falls under the NAICS code 811212, relevant to medical equipment repair and maintenance. Issued by the Department of Veterans Affairs through the 261-NETWORK Contract Office 21, the services will be performed in Honolulu. The solicitation was posted on May 4, 2026, with a response deadline of May 13, 2026. This opportunity aims to support the upkeep and operational reliability of critical respiratory medical equipment that serves veterans, highlighting the importance of quality and timely service in healthcare settings.
